35-10-305: Partnership liable for partner's actionable conduct.

(1) A partnership is liable for loss or injury caused to a person, or for a penalty incurred, as a result of a wrongful act or omission or other actionable conduct of a partner acting in the ordinary course of business of the partnership or with the authority of the partnership.

(2) If, in the course of its business, a partnership receives money or property of a person not a partner and that money or property is misapplied by a partner while it is in the custody of the partnership, the partnership is liable for the loss.
